Great dispersed camping

There are several spots with established fire pits. Secluded yet close to Cannon Beach. Road was very accessible. Creek and trailhead nearby. Spot at the dead end is best.

What amenities are available at Soapstone Lake Campground?

Soapstone Lake Trail dispersed camping offers several established fire pits throughout the area. As a dispersed camping location, it provides a more primitive experience without developed facilities like bathrooms or running water. There is a creek nearby for water access (though treatment is recommended before use), and the area features a trailhead for hiking opportunities. The spot at the dead end is considered the best camping location. Being a dispersed site, campers should plan to pack in all supplies and pack out all waste.

Are there any camping fees or permits required for Soapstone Lake?

Soapstone Lake Trail dispersed camping appears to be free to use as a dispersed camping area. However, it's always recommended to check with the managing agency (likely the U.S. Forest Service or Bureau of Land Management) before your trip for any changes to permit requirements or seasonal restrictions. Some dispersed camping areas may have stay limits, typically 14 days within a 30-day period, though specific regulations may vary.
